Senior living homes, often called assisted living communities, are designed for individuals who value their independence but may need some help with daily activities like dressing, bathing, or medication management. The core philosophy is to offer just the right amount of support to empower residents to live fully. This is particularly meaningful in a close-knit area like Swan River, where knowing your neighbors and having a familiar face nearby is a cherished part of life. These communities strive to recreate that sense of belonging, often with staff who become like extended family.
When considering options, it’s helpful to look beyond the physical building. The right community fosters engagement. Look for a calendar of activities that resonates with your loved one’s interests—perhaps card games, gardening clubs suited to our Minnesota growing season, or local history talks. Social connection is a powerful medicine, combating the isolation that can sometimes accompany aging, especially during our long winters. A good community will have inviting common areas where residents naturally gather, sharing stories over coffee, much like they might have at the local café.
Practical considerations for Swan River families should include the community’s approach to our distinct climate. Ask about safety protocols for ice and snow, the availability of secure indoor walking paths for year-round exercise, and how they handle transportation to medical appointments in larger nearby towns when the weather turns. Nutrition is another key area. Many seniors find cooking for one to be a chore, leading to poor eating habits. Dining services in senior living provide not only balanced, chef-prepared meals but also a social event to look forward to each day.
We encourage you to visit potential homes more than once, and at different times of the day. Notice the interactions between staff and residents. Are they warm and respectful? Do the residents seem content and engaged? Trust your instincts, and involve your loved one in the process as much as possible. This transition is about their future happiness.
